Ginsters to Launch New Limited Edition Buffalo Chicken Pocket with Frank’s RedHot Buffalo Wing Sauce
Ginsters, the number 1 brand in Savoury Pastry, has teamed up with the world’s number 1 Hot Sauce brand[1], Frank’s RedHot, to bring a new flavour sensation to front of store snacking. The Ginsters Limited Edition Buffalo Chicken Pocket with Frank’s RedHot Buffalo Wing Sauce (100g) will be spicing up front of store chillers from 23rd March, so Frank’s and Ginsters fans can enjoy the much-loved sauce on the go.
Ginsters launched their handheld Pockets in March 2025 to capitalise on the desire for impulsivity in snacking. This reflects the fact that 54% of savoury pastry purchase decisions are made in store, making it an even more impulsive category than confectionary at 49%[2]. Lifestyles are busier than ever, and the snacking market is worth a huge £15.2billion[3] with nearly three quarters (73%)[4] of people who snack doing so at least once a day. Ginsters Pockets, packed full of street-food flavours, have made a big impact since launch, recruiting 810k [5] new shoppers to the category. In the front of store, Ginsters are seeing double the growth of total Savoury Pastry and are the brand driving the most actual sales to the front of store area[6] bringing in new, younger consumers.
In a continuation of Ginsters Limited Edition strategy, the new collaboration with Frank’s RedHot follows a phenomenal partnership with Marmite, that has brought over 60k new shoppers to the brand[7] since launching in March 2025. This latest brand partnership will be supported with a £220k investment across social media, PR and shopper marketing, alongside social support from Frank’s across Instagram and Tiktok, helping to amplify launch content and drive engagement.
Packed with 100% British chicken and made with no additives, artificial colours or preservatives, the new Limited Edition Buffalo Chicken Pocket with Frank’s RedHot, delivers the perfect blend of flavour and heat in pastry form and is set to drive incremental growth for the category amongst under 35s, the UK’s most prolific snackers[8]. The bold new flavour will tap into shopper desire for exciting new flavour combinations and stand out in the impulsive front of store snacking space.
